One of the key benefits of working with a specialist employment solicitor is their in-depth knowledge and expertise in the field of employment law. Employment law is a complex and constantly evolving area of law, with numerous statutes, regulations, and case law precedents that can be difficult for non-specialists to navigate. specialist employment solicitors have the training and experience necessary to interpret and apply these legal principles to real-world situations, ensuring that their clients receive accurate and up-to-date legal advice.
For individuals seeking representation in an employment dispute, a specialist employment solicitor can provide invaluable assistance in reviewing employment contracts, negotiating settlements, and representing their interests in employment tribunals or court proceedings. Whether you have been unfairly dismissed, discriminated against, or subjected to workplace harassment, a specialist employment solicitor can assess the merits of your case, advise you on your legal rights and options, and help you achieve a favorable outcome.
Similarly, businesses can benefit from the expertise of specialist employment solicitors in ensuring compliance with employment laws and regulations, drafting employment contracts and policies, and managing disputes with employees. By working with a specialist employment solicitor, employers can proactively address potential legal issues before they escalate into costly and time-consuming disputes, thereby protecting their business interests and reputation.
